Benefits of Using Advanced Cultivation Systems in Bioalgae Technology
1. Increased Efficiency
Using advanced cultivation systems in bioalgae technology can significantly increase the efficiency of algae cultivation. These systems often incorporate advanced monitoring and control mechanisms, allowing for precise control of environmental factors such as temperature, light intensity, and nutrient availability. This optimization of conditions can lead to higher growth rates and biomass productivity, ultimately maximizing the yield of bioalgae.2. Enhanced Nutrient Utilization
Advanced cultivation systems enable better utilization of nutrients by bioalgae. Through the implementation of advanced nutrient delivery systems, the availability and uptake of essential nutrients can be optimized. 3. Reduced Water Consumption
Water scarcity is a significant concern in many regions, making water conservation crucial in agricultural practices. Advanced cultivation systems in bioalgae technology often incorporate water recycling and reclamation techniques. These systems can capture and treat wastewater, allowing it to be reused for algae cultivation. By reducing water consumption and minimizing the need for freshwater inputs, advanced cultivation systems contribute to sustainable and environmentally friendly bioalgae production.4. Improved Contamination Control
Contamination by unwanted microorganisms can hinder the growth and productivity of bioalgae cultures. Advanced cultivation systems employ various strategies to minimize contamination risks. These may include the use of closed or semi-closed cultivation systems, sterilization techniques, and advanced monitoring systems to detect and prevent the growth of contaminants. 5. Scalability and Commercial Viability
Advanced cultivation systems in bioalgae technology are designed with scalability and commercial viability in mind. These systems are often modular and can be easily scaled up or down to meet specific production requirements. Additionally, the precise control and optimization of cultivation conditions provided by these systems contribute to consistent and reliable biomass production, making bioalgae cultivation economically viable on a larger scale.6. Environmental Benefits
Bioalgae technology offers several environmental benefits, and advanced cultivation systems further enhance these advantages. Algae cultivation can capture and utilize carbon dioxide (CO2) from various sources, including industrial emissions, helping to mitigate greenhouse gas emissions. Additionally, bioalgae can be used to treat wastewater, removing pollutants and excess nutrients, thus reducing the environmental impact of wastewater discharge.
